1. She hoped that the pain would __________, but it __________ everyday.
a) deny, added
b) subside, worsened
c) mend, descended
d) obliterate, augmented
e) abate, lessened

2. Businesses today are so __________ involved with and __________ upon national economics that they must be involved in national fiscal planning.
a) intimately, dependent
b) hardly, based
c) secretly, pushed
d) desperately, neglected
e) firmly, based

3. If you are not __________ with the purchase, you may __________ it for a refund in ten days.
a) provided, ship
b) seen, retain
c) pleased, find
d) found, send
e) satisfied, return

Antonyms

4. Satiety
a) starvation
b) pretence
c) grandeur
d) lowest class

5. Amenable
a) intractable
b) responsive
c) agreeable
d) indifferent

6. Ameliorate
a) coarsen
b) harden
c) improve
d) worsen

7. Choleric
a) irritable
b) serene
c) severe
d) stern

8. Imbecile
a) lunatic
b) ordinary
c) sane
d) plentiful

Synonyms

9. Hone
a) croon
b) mourn
c) whittle
d) sharpen

10. Assiduously
a) sarcastically
b) diligently
c) enthusiastically
d) rationally

11. Feline
a) cat like
b) dog like
c) sleek
d) feminine

12. Slew
a) waste material
b) opening
c) scattering
d) large number

Analogies

13. Snake : Reptile
a) patch : thread
b) removal : snow
c) struggle : wrestle
d) hand : clock

14. Naïve : Cheat
a) gullible : shrewd
b) cunning : clever
c) hurt : retaliate
d) sensible : foolish

15. Bones : Ligaments
a) fracture : cast
b) muscle : tendon
c) fat : cell
d) knuckle : finger
e) knee : joint

16. Couplet : Poem
a) page : letter
b) sentence : paragraph
c) number : address
d) epic : poetry
e) biography : novel

Choose the correct sentence.


17. a) His youngest son has just started going to the school
b) His youngest son has started just going to school
c) His youngest son has just started going to school
d) His youngest son have just started going to school

18. a) Must he go? No, he must.
b) Must he go? Yes, he should.
c) Must he go? No, must he.
d) Must he go? No, he needn’t.

19. a) I wont’ let you leaving till the end of the act.
b) I wont’ let you leave till the end of the act.
c) I wont’ let you leaving to the end of act.
d) I wont’ let you to leave by the end of the act.

20. a) When he was charged of murder, he said he had an alibi.
b) When he was charged with a murder, he said he has an alibi.
c) When he was charged with murder, he said he had an alibi.
d) When he was charged with murder, he say he had an alibi.
